Description[?]:
Seeing that Hutori's law is quite federal at some points, it would be interesting to know, who is actually in charge of the different provinces, especially as there are provincial police units. I therefore propose, that the party that gets the most votes in a province designs a leader. According to the last elections, posts are as follows: Falristan: VSC Kenai: LCAP Roccato, Lagard, Adelia: HCC |
